Systematic name YHL022C
Gene name SPO11
Aliases
Feature type ORF, Verified
Coordinates Chr VIII:64157..62961
Primary SGDID S000001014


Description of YHL022C: Meiosis-specific protein that initiates meiotic recombination by catalyzing the formation of double-strand breaks in DNA via a transesterification reaction; required for homologous chromosome pairing and synaptonemal complex formation[1][2]

Interactions

Two Hybrid

Two Hybrid interaction with Rec104
meiosis-specific two hybrid interaction requires presence of endogenous SKI8 and REC102 genes [3] [4]


Two Hybrid interaction with ski8
[3] [4]


Protein Details

Protein Modification

Modification(s): Phosphorylation

Identified as an efficient substrate of Clb2-Cdk1-as1 in a screen of a proteomic GST-fusion library. [5] [6]
